Role of the N-terminal EGF module of coagulation factor IX in activation of factors IX and X.
Absence or reduced activity of coagulation factor IX (FIX) causes the severe bleeding disorder haemophilia B. FIX contains a Gla module, two epidermal growth factor-like (EGF) modules, and a serine protease region.
